In today's episode of [No Recipes], chef Marc Matsumoto introduces us to the Japanese beef and rice bowl known as "guydon."
Not just any guydon, this one is a modified homage to the Japanese fast food chain Yoshinoya. The restaurant had its beginnings in Tokyo in 1899, and now owns stores around the Pacific Rim and in four U.S. states (sadly, none in the Southeast).
Simple and inexpensive to make, it's a great receipe to try on your own.
